Title: Data Analyst 4
Location: Onsite/Redmond, WA
 
Job Description
Primary Responsibilities
• Develop, maintain, and enhance staffing and workforce planning models.
• Build and optimize data pipelines using Azure Data Factory (ADF) and related Azure services.
• Develop analytical solutions and automation using SQL and Python.
• Manage and support Azure SQL environments, including database administration, monitoring, and performance tuning.
• Support data integrations, ETL processes, and reporting solutions.
• Work with tabular data models, including SSAS cubes.
• Ensure data quality, reliability, and scalability across planning and reporting platforms.
• Partner with business stakeholders to translate workforce planning requirements into analytical solutions.

Required Skills
• Advanced SQL development and database design expertise
• Strong Python programming skills for data analysis, automation, and data engineering tasks
• Experience with Azure SQL Database administration, performance tuning, and troubleshooting
• Azure Data Factory (ADF) pipeline development and maintenance
• Experience building and maintaining analytical and forecasting models
• Familiarity with SQL Server Analysis Services (SSAS) cubes and dimensional modeling
• Understanding of Azure data platform services and cloud-based data architectures
• Strong analytical, troubleshooting, and communication skills.
